As his manager announced on Wednesday, he died following a fall. More significantly, a common symptom of certain types of leukemia is faulty blood clotting, typically due to low levels of platelets although other issues can also be involved. In the short term, falls that involve trauma to the head can cause life-threatening intracranial bleeding. what kind of cancer did leonard cohen have deadly premonition 2 enemies lewis and clark called it the seal river codycross . According to one episode of Malcolm Gladwell's podcast, "Revisionist History," it took Cohen five years to write a version of "Hallelujah" he was satisfied with. A fall bad enough to warrant hospital admission can carry as poor a prognosis as some stage IV cancers that have metastasized to the lungs and brain. In summary, the most likely clinical interpretation of the presented data is that Leonards death was the consequence of bleeding which was immediately triggered by his fall and which continued unabated because of a coagulation defect, which was itself caused by leukemia.
